ライフサイクル管理ポリシーを変更します。
デバッグ
リクエストパラメーター
パラメーター | データ型 | 必須/任意 | 例 | 説明 |
---|---|---|---|---|
操作 | String | 必須 | ModifyLifecyclePolicy |
実行する操作です。 値をModifyLifecyclePolicyに設定します。 |
FileSystemId | String | 必須 | 31a8e4 **** |
ファイルシステムの ID。 |
LifecyclePolicyName | String | 必須 | lifecyclepolicy_01 |
ライフサイクル管理ポリシーの名前。 |
LifecycleRuleName | String | 必須 | DEFAULT_ATIME_14 |
ライフサイクル管理ポリシーのルール。 設定可能な値は以下のとおりです。
|
パス | String | 任意 | /pathway/to /フォルダ |
ライフサイクル管理ポリシーが関連付けられているディレクトリの絶対パス。 パスの先頭にはスラッシュ (/) を付ける必要があります。 マウントターゲットに存在するパスである必要があります。 |
StorageType | String | 任意 | 非頻繁なアクセス |
IAストレージメディアにダンプされるデータのストレージタイプ。 デフォルト値: InfrequentAccess (IA) 。 |
レスポンスパラメーター
パラメーター | データ型 | 例 | 説明 |
---|---|---|---|
RequestId | String | BC7C825C-5F65-4B56-BEF6-98C56C7C **** |
リクエストの ID。 |
Success | Boolean | true |
Indicates whether the request has succeeded. 設定可能な値は以下のとおりです。
|
例
リクエストの例
http(s):// [エンドポイント]/?Action=ModifyLifecyclePolicy
&FileSystemId=31a8e4 ****
&LifecyclePolicyName=lifecyclepolicy_01
&LifecycleRuleName=DEFAULT_ATIME_14
&<共通リクエストパラメータ>
正常に処理された場合のレスポンス例
XML
形式
<RequestId>BC7C825C-5F65-4B56-BEF6-98C56C7C ****</RequestId>
<Success>true</Success>
JSON
形式
{
"RequestId": "BC7C825C-5F65-4B56-BEF6-98C56C7C ****" 、
"成功": 真
}
エラーコード
HttpCode | エラーコード | エラーメッセージ | 必須/任意 |
---|---|---|---|
400 | InvalidLifecyclePolicy.NotFound | 指定されたLifecyclePolicyは存在しません。 | 指定されたライフサイクルポリシーが存在しない場合に返されるエラーメッセージ。 |
404 | InvalidLifecycleRule.NotFound | 指定されたLifecycleRuleは存在しません。 | 指定されたライフサイクル管理ルールが存在しない場合に返されるエラーメッセージ。 |
404 | InvalidFileSystem.NotFound | 指定されたファイルシステムが存在しません。 | The error message returned because the specified file system does not exist. |
エラーコードリストについては、「API エラーセンター」をご参照ください。